https://www.theage.com.au/sport/afl/eagle-s-early-flight-no-stress-for-simpson-20181203-p50jyi.html



Ryan didn't cope with the experience as well as some, but Simpson dismissed reports he had walked out on the camp.

"If people are struggling we don't take it any further and Liam struggled," Simpson told reporters.


"It was a physical camp. He's pretty fit, he ran well [on Monday], but he didn't handle it too well at the back end so we pulled him out and we took him home.

"Nothing too sinister. From what I heard reported as well [it] was a bit different than what actually happened.

"It's not 1985. We're not here to break these guys. It was to test them physically and he didn't get through it, but that's OK.

"I'm not too stressed about that."
